  13. DCI history shows that if you want a chance to win a championship, you have to be in one of 5 corps. Thus far in the decade of the 2000's-B/D,Cadets,Cavies,SCV,Phantom are the only to finish top 3. In the 90's......................................B/D,Cadets,Cavies,SCV,Phantom+ Star(gone) In the 80's......................................B/D,Cadets,Cavies,SCV,Phantom+Madison(twice)+27(gone)& Bridgemen(gone) Maybe some corps will break through that barrier.
